    How much does a Red Cross Rn make in Texas?

    As of Aug 31, 2026, the average annual pay for a Red Cross Rn in Texas is $87,035 a year.

    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$41.84 an hour. This is the equivalent of $1,673/week or $7,252/month.

    While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$135,556 and as low as $46,583, the majority of Red Cross Rn salaries currently range between $66,600 (25th percentile) to $103,400 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$121,115 annually in Texas. The average pay range for a Red Cross Rn varies greatly (by as much as 36800),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

    Texas ranks number 50 out of 50 states nationwide for Red Cross Rn salaries.
